PG Electroplast Ltd reported unaudited financial results for the quarter ended June 30, 2026, with revenues crossing INR 2,000 crores for the first time in its history, driven by a 35.2% YoY growth. The company's EBITDA and net profit also grew by 12.1% and 12.9% YoY, respectively. The company has a strong future outlook, with plans to achieve industry-leading revenue growth, drive margin expansion, and maintain best-in-class capital efficiency.

(PGEL), one of India’s pioneers and leading players in Electronic Manufacturing Services (EMS) and Plastic Molding, announced its unaudited financial results for the quarter ended June 30, 2026, as approved by its Board of Directors. “This has been a landmark quarter for PGEL, with consolidated revenues crossing INR 2,000 crores for the first time in our history. The broader industry is now coming out of a difficult stretch marked by successive demand and supply shocks, and the underlying indicators point to a genuine recovery. Given the relatively low penetration levels in core categories like Room ACs and Washing Machines, we see significant long-term headroom for growth. We remain focused on product innovation, capital-efficient expansion, and deepening our client partnerships, with investments in new platform development and capability enhancement across our core product lines progressing as planned. All capex decisions continue to be guided by sustainable profitability and long-term value creation. Our future outlook remains strong, and we are committed to building a resilient, high- performing organization.” — Vikas Gupta, Managing Director – Operations Quarter ended June 30th, 2026 • Revenues stood at INR 2,034.0 crores, up 35.2% YoY • EBITDA stood at INR 156.2 crores vs. INR 139.4 crores in 1QFY26 – growth of 12.1% • Net Profit for the quarter stood at INR 75.3 crores, vs. INR 66.7 crores in 1QFY26, growth of 12.9% Other Highlights • 1QFY27 has been a strong growth period as consolidated quarterly revenues crossed INR 2,000 crores for the first time in the company's history. • Our 100% subsidiary, PG Technoplast, reported INR 1,628.9 crores in revenue. The order book remains healthy across all product categories. • Product business contributed 80.2% of total revenues in 1QFY27, growing 40.7% YoY, with the AC business growing 38.1% YoY to INR 1,401.4 crores, the Washing Machines business growing 67.2% to INR 210.8 crores, and Coolers growing 3.4% YoY to INR 18.9 crores. • The Electronics business grew 65.3% YoY and contributed 5.3% of total revenues. Plastic Moulding and components contributed INR 294.55 crores, and grew 7.5% YoY. • Our 50:50 JV, Goodworth Electronics, posted revenues of INR 177.3 crores in 1QFY27 vs. INR 147.5 crores in 1QFY26, with EBITDA of INR 6.3 crores vs. INR 4.3 crores YoY. • PGEL’s flagship Washing Machine manufacturing facility has come online in a new campus in DMIC, Greater Noida, Uttar Pradesh. A state-of-the-art plant, it will have the capacity to manufacture 1.8mn washing machines per annum. • Gross contribution as a percentage softened YoY due to elevated commodity prices. Since product pricing in the industry is typically structured on a per-unit rupee margin basis, rising input costs mechanically lower the margin percentage even as per-unit economics stay stable. Raw material cost increases have been partially passed through to customers. • Cash & Bank Balances stood at INR 491.3 crores at the end of 1QFY27, and the company returned to a net cash position after a net debt position in 4QFY26. • Our focus on controlling expenses in FY27 is already bearing fruit, and we remain committed to building long-term resilience and enhancing capital efficiency. • Strategic priorities include R&D, new product development, backward integration, and capability enhancement. The company plans to continue investing in developing capabilities and capacities in existing and adjacent product segments to support future growth. Future Outlook The management sees increased opportunities from both existing and new clients. With enhanced capacities and technological capabilities, PGEL is well-positioned in India's consumer durables and plastics ecosystem. In the coming years, the company aims to: • Achieve industry-leading revenue growth • Drive gradual margin expansion through operational efficiencies and operating leverage • Maintain best-in-class capital efficiency through improved cash flows and balance sheet optimization Several capacity projects initiated over the past year are progressing toward commercialization and are expected to come online through FY27, including: • The refrigerator campus in Sri City, Andhra Pradesh • The state of the art room air conditioner compressor manufacturing plant in Supa, Maharashtra • The facility for plastic components, tooling, and coolers in Salarpur, Rajasthan About PG Electroplast Limited (PGEL) (BSE: 533581; NSE: PGEL) PG Electroplast is a trusted one-stop solution provider for Electronic Manufacturing Services (EMS) and contract manufacturing to most leading consumer durable and electronics brands in India. The company has one of the biggest capacities in Plastic Injection moulding and has capabilities across the value chain in Original Equipment Manufacturing (OEM) and Original Design Manufacturing (ODM) products like Washing Machines, Room ACs, Air-Coolers and LED TVs.
